A luminous and courageous documentary that confronts the pain of paternal absence, FATHER’S DAY seeks understanding, agency, and reconciliation. Sparked by her father’s departure when she was two years old, O’Shun sets out to examine why so many fathers are absent in Black communities across North America — and how this absence shapes daughters, families, and collective futures.
